Re: road legal moto x bikes

there are loads of choices out there, the honda crf230, yamaha serrow225 (kick and electric start) or better still the gas gas pampera (2 stroke and kick start but incredibely easy to start and even easier to ride) give em all a look 8)

Re: Caliper Swapping

i have chopped and changed nissan, tockico 6 and 4 pots on my tl and find the 6 pots work best but only if you use decent sintered pads which is the prob with most brakes, i prob would have been as well just to use sintered pads and braided lines with the 4 pots with equally good results. i had at o...
